The Ben Afleck-Justin Timberlake film about online poker, “Runner, Runner”, has bombed at the box office.

The film, which was widely panned by critics, finished third behind “Gravity” and “Cloudy With a Chance of Meatballs 2” (there was a number one?).

“Runner, Runner” took in $7.6 million its opening weekend. Compare that with “Gravity”, which shattered all-time October box office records with a $55.6 showing. 

Business Insider’s Kristen Acuna writes:

This was kind of surprising since the marketing for the Brad Furman film was there. It was easy for the film to get lost since it was directly competing for the same audience as Warner Bros.' tentpole "Gravity" this weekend. It also didn't help that the film received a "C" CinemaScore from viewers. Despite its low opening weekend, the film is faring better overseas.
